117.info
人生若只如初见

Ubuntu上SQL Server日志管理技巧有哪些

在Ubuntu上管理SQL Server日志时,可以采用以下几种技巧和策略:

日志文件的位置和类型

  • 错误日志:记录了SQL Server在运行过程中遇到的所有错误或警告信息。默认情况下,错误日志文件位于 /var/log/sqlserver/error.log
  • 通用查询日志:记录了所有客户端对SQL Server的查询请求。默认情况下,通用查询日志文件位于 /var/log/sqlserver/general.log
  • 事务日志:记录了所有事务的详细信息,对于恢复操作非常重要。

日志管理工具

  • Logrotate:用于自动轮换、压缩、删除和发送日志文件,防止单个文件过大。配置文件通常位于 /etc/logrotate.d/sqlserver
  • Rsyslog:一个强大的日志处理工具,提供高性能日志处理,支持多种输出格式和过滤选项。配置文件位于 /etc/rsyslog.conf
  • Systemd journal:集成在systemd中的日志系统,提供索引化和查询日志的能力,即使在系统崩溃后也能保留日志信息。

日志分析技巧

  • 使用命令行工具如 tail -fcatgrep 等实时查看和分析日志文件。
  • 利用 journalctl 命令查询特定时间段的日志。
  • 使用日志分析工具如 Logwatch、Logalyze 等进行深入分析。

日志备份策略

  • 设置恢复模型:选择完整恢复模型可以更好地管理操作日志。
  • 创建备份计划:使用 SQL Server Agent 创建定期备份操作日志的计划。
  • 监控和管理操作日志:定期检查日志文件的大小,并通过查询获取当前日志空间的使用情况。

日志还原策略

  • 根据业务需求确定还原策略,如完全还原、增量还原或特定时间点还原。
  • 定期测试还原过程,以确保在需要时能够成功恢复数据库。

监控和报告

  • 使用 SQL Server Management Studio(SSMS)或其他监控工具来监控日志备份的状态和性能。
  • 配置报告功能,以便定期生成备份报告和摘要。

请注意,上述信息基于一般的Linux系统和SQL Server日志管理实践,具体配置和操作可能会因版本和特定需求而异。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fed41AzsNBANVBl0.html

推荐文章

  • Ubuntu FTPServer如何管理用户账户

    在Ubuntu上管理FTP服务器的用户账户,通常涉及到使用vsftpd(Very Secure FTP Daemon)这个流行的FTP服务器软件。以下是一些基本步骤来管理vsftpd中的用户账户:...

  • Ubuntu Golang打包工具怎么选

    在Ubuntu上使用Golang打包应用时,你可以选择以下几种工具和方法:
    1. 使用 go build 命令
    go build 是Go语言自带的打包工具,可以编译Go程序并生成可...

  • Ubuntu中cop launcher怎么配置

    在Ubuntu中配置“COP launcher”可能涉及到创建和配置启动器。虽然搜索结果中没有直接提到“COP launcher”,但可以参考创建一般启动器的步骤,这些步骤可能适用...

  • ubuntu上jellyfin配置教程

    在Ubuntu上配置Jellyfin的步骤如下:
    1. 安装Jellyfin
    方法一:使用Snap安装 打开终端。
    运行以下命令来安装Jellyfin:sudo snap install jellyf...

  • Linux驱动开发中的内存管理

    在Linux驱动开发中,内存管理是一个非常重要的部分。它涉及到如何有效地分配、使用和释放内存资源。以下是一些关于Linux驱动开发中内存管理的要点: 内核空间与用...

  • Node.js与Ubuntu兼容性问题大吗

    Node.js与Ubuntu的兼容性问题通常不大,但确实存在一些需要注意的地方。以下是一些关键点:
    兼容性概述 长期支持版本(LTS):使用LTS版本的Node.js可以确保...

  • Ubuntu Trigger在实际项目中的应用案例

    Ubuntu Trigger 并不是一个在Ubuntu系统中内置的命令或工具。可能你是指 Cron 任务、Triggerhappy 或者与 Tekton 相关的自动化工具。以下是一些相关的应用案例和...

  • Debian系统中fetchdebian的安全性如何

    Debian系统,包括通过APT包管理器获取软件包的过程(通常称为“fetchdebian”),被广泛认为是安全的。这主要得益于其稳定性、严格的安全措施、庞大的软件仓库以...